CDC Set to Acquire Transportation Management Solutions
- Posted on 09 September 2010
CDC Software signs a term sheet to acquire a provider of cloud-based transportation management solutions. CDC believes this targeted acquisition will allow it to offer new transportation and logistics technology that is expected to complement its portfolio of enterprise applications, particularly the recently acquired CDC TradeBeam global trade management solution.
In addition to CDC TradeBeam, this acquisition is expected to provide additional functionality and generate new cross-selling opportunities with CDC's other products that include: CDC Supply Chain, CDC Ross ERP, and CDC eBizNET, a supply chain execution solution.
The transaction is part of CDC's acquisition strategy to increase its maintenance and SaaS recurring revenue to about 70 percent of total revenue over the next few years.
